i just rebuilt my carbs and i'm trying to adjust them, but i can't get the idle to come down. as soon as i start the car, it zooms up to 2,000 rpm and it won't come down. when i tried to drive it, the power is just not there. it seems like it has better power at the 2000 rpm idle than when i try to push the gas. even if i turn the idle adjust screws all the way out, it doesn't bring the idle down at all. is it some huge vacuum leak i've got here? any other reason i wouldn't be able to bring the idle down?
